Step 1: Assessment and Planning
Our technicians will arrive at your location, assess the damage, and develop a customized plan to remove the water from your garage. This includes identifying the source of the water, the extent of the damage, and the equipment needed to complete the job.
Step 2: Water Extraction
Our team will use specialized equipment to extract as much water as possible from your garage. This includes powerful pumps and wet vacuums that can handle large volumes of water. We’ll also use absorbent materials to soak up any remaining water and prevent further damage.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
After the water has been extracted, our team will focus on drying and dehumidifying your garage. This involves using specialized equipment to remove any remaining moisture from the air, walls, and floors. We’ll also use dehumidifiers to prevent mold growth and ensure your garage is completely dry.
Step 4: Cleaning and Sanitizing
Once your garage is dry, our team will clean and sanitize the area to prevent any further damage or health risks. This includes using disinfectants to kill any bacteria or mold that may have developed during the water removal process.
Step 5: Final Inspection and Touch-ups
Our team will conduct a final inspection to ensure your garage is completely dry and free of any remaining water damage. We’ll also make any necessary touch-ups to ensure your garage is restored to its original condition.

Warning Signs You Need Garage Water Removal
Water damage in your garage can lead to costly repairs and even health risks if left unchecked. Here are some warning signs to look out for:
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
If you notice a persistent musty smell in your garage, it’s a sign that mold and mildew are growing. This can be a health risk, especially for people with allergies or respiratory issues.
Warped or Discolored Flooring
If your garage flooring is warped or discolored, it’s a sign that water has seeped into the floor and caused damage. This can lead to costly repairs if left unchecked.
Water Stains on Walls and Ceilings
Water stains on your garage walls and ceilings are a clear sign of water damage. This can lead to further damage and even structural issues if left unchecked.
Standing Water in the Garage
Standing water in your garage is a sign that the water removal process has not been completed correctly. This can lead to further damage and even health risks if left unchecked.
Visible Signs of Mold or Mildew
Visible signs of mold or mildew in your garage are a clear sign that water damage has occurred. This can be a health risk, especially for people with allergies or respiratory issues.
Unusual Sounds or Squeaks
Unusual sounds or squeaks coming from your garage can be a sign that water damage has caused structural issues. This can lead to costly repairs if left unchecked.

Garage Water Removal Cost In Melissa, TX
The cost of Garage Water Removal in Melissa, TX, varies dep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Here are some estimated price ranges for common Garage Water Removal services: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water Extraction | $500 – $2,000 | The amount of water extracted, the size of the affected area, and the equipment needed. |
| Drying and Dehumidification | $200 – $1,000 | The size of the affected area, the amount of moisture present, and the equipment needed. |
| Cleaning and Sanitizing | $100 – $500 | The size of the affected area, the amount of mold or mildew present, and the equipment needed. |
| Structural Repairs | $1,000 – $5,000 | The extent of the damage, the size of the affected area, and the materials needed. |
| Electrical Repairs | $500 – $2,000 | The extent of the damage, the size of the affected area, and the materials needed. |
| More Services (mold remediation, etc.) | $500 – $2,000 | The extent of the damage, the size of the affected area, and the materials needed. |

Common Questions About Garage Water Removal
Q: How long does the water removal process take?
A: The water removal process typically takes 3-5 days to complete, depending on the size of the affected area and the amount of water present. Our team will work efficiently to get your garage back to its original condition as quickly as possible.
Q: Is water damage in the garage covered by insurance?
A: Yes, water damage in the garage is typically covered by homeowners insurance. But, the specifics of your policy will depend on the circumstances of the damage. Our team can help you navigate the insurance process and ensure you receive the coverage you deserve.
Q: Can I prevent water damage in my garage?
A: Yes, you can prevent water damage in your garage by regularly inspecting your garage for signs of water damage, ensuring proper drainage, and addressing any issues quickly. Our team can also provide recommendations on how to prevent water damage in your garage.
Q: What equipment do you use for water removal?
A: Our team uses state-of-the-art equipment, including powerful pumps and wet vacuums, to extract water from your garage. We also use specialized equipment to dry and dehumidify the area to prevent further damage.
